Class IndexEndpointServiceStub
- java.lang.Object
-
- com.google.cloud.aiplatform.v1.stub.IndexEndpointServiceStub
-
- All Implemented Interfaces:
com.google.api.gax.core.BackgroundResource
,AutoCloseable
- Direct Known Subclasses:
GrpcIndexEndpointServiceStub
@Generated("by gapic-generator-java") public abstract class IndexEndpointServiceStub extends Object implements com.google.api.gax.core.BackgroundResource
Base stub class for the IndexEndpointService service API.This class is for advanced usage and reflects the underlying API directly.
-
-
Constructor Summary
Constructors Constructor Description IndexEndpointServiceStub()
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description abstract void
close()
com.google.api.gax.rpc.UnaryCallable<CreateIndexEndpointRequest,com.google.longrunning.Operation>
createIndexEndpointCallable()
com.google.api.gax.rpc.OperationCallable<CreateIndexEndpointRequest,IndexEndpoint,CreateIndexEndpointOperationMetadata>
createIndexEndpointOperationCallable()
com.google.api.gax.rpc.UnaryCallable<DeleteIndexEndpointRequest,com.google.longrunning.Operation>
deleteIndexEndpointCallable()
com.google.api.gax.rpc.OperationCallable<DeleteIndexEndpointRequest,com.google.protobuf.Empty,DeleteOperationMetadata>
deleteIndexEndpointOperationCallable()
com.google.api.gax.rpc.UnaryCallable<DeployIndexRequest,com.google.longrunning.Operation>
deployIndexCallable()
com.google.api.gax.rpc.OperationCallable<DeployIndexRequest,DeployIndexResponse,DeployIndexOperationMetadata>
deployIndexOperationCallable()
com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.GetIamPolicyRequest,com.google.iam.v1.Policy>
getIamPolicyCallable()
com.google.api.gax.rpc.UnaryCallable<GetIndexEndpointRequest,IndexEndpoint>
getIndexEndpointCallable()
com.google.api.gax.rpc.UnaryCallable<com.google.cloud.location.GetLocationRequest,com.google.cloud.location.Location>
getLocationCallable()
com.google.longrunning.stub.OperationsStub
getOperationsStub()
com.google.api.gax.rpc.UnaryCallable<ListIndexEndpointsRequest,ListIndexEndpointsResponse>
listIndexEndpointsCallable()
com.google.api.gax.rpc.UnaryCallable<ListIndexEndpointsRequest,IndexEndpointServiceClient.ListIndexEndpointsPagedResponse>
listIndexEndpointsPagedCallable()
com.google.api.gax.rpc.UnaryCallable<com.google.cloud.location.ListLocationsRequest,com.google.cloud.location.ListLocationsResponse>
listLocationsCallable()
com.google.api.gax.rpc.UnaryCallable<com.google.cloud.location.ListLocationsRequest,IndexEndpointServiceClient.ListLocationsPagedResponse>
listLocationsPagedCallable()
com.google.api.gax.rpc.UnaryCallable<MutateDeployedIndexRequest,com.google.longrunning.Operation>
mutateDeployedIndexCallable()
com.google.api.gax.rpc.OperationCallable<MutateDeployedIndexRequest,MutateDeployedIndexResponse,MutateDeployedIndexOperationMetadata>
mutateDeployedIndexOperationCallable()
com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.SetIamPolicyRequest,com.google.iam.v1.Policy>
setIamPolicyCallable()
com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.TestIamPermissionsRequest,com.google.iam.v1.TestIamPermissionsResponse>
testIamPermissionsCallable()
com.google.api.gax.rpc.UnaryCallable<UndeployIndexRequest,com.google.longrunning.Operation>
undeployIndexCallable()
com.google.api.gax.rpc.OperationCallable<UndeployIndexRequest,UndeployIndexResponse,UndeployIndexOperationMetadata>
undeployIndexOperationCallable()
com.google.api.gax.rpc.UnaryCallable<UpdateIndexEndpointRequest,IndexEndpoint>
updateIndexEndpointCallable()
-
-
-
Method Detail
-
getOperationsStub
public com.google.longrunning.stub.OperationsStub getOperationsStub()
-
createIndexEndpointOperationCallable
public com.google.api.gax.rpc.OperationCallable<CreateIndexEndpointRequest,IndexEndpoint,CreateIndexEndpointOperationMetadata> createIndexEndpointOperationCallable()
-
createIndexEndpointCallable
public com.google.api.gax.rpc.UnaryCallable<CreateIndexEndpointRequest,com.google.longrunning.Operation> createIndexEndpointCallable()
-
getIndexEndpointCallable
public com.google.api.gax.rpc.UnaryCallable<GetIndexEndpointRequest,IndexEndpoint> getIndexEndpointCallable()
-
listIndexEndpoints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<ListIndexEndpointsRequest,IndexEndpointServiceClient.ListIndexEndpointsPagedResponse> listIndexEndpointsPagedCallable()
-
listIndexEndpointsCallable
public com.google.api.gax.rpc.UnaryCallable<ListIndexEndpointsRequest,ListIndexEndpointsResponse> listIndexEndpointsCallable()
-
updateIndexEndpointCallable
public com.google.api.gax.rpc.UnaryCallable<UpdateIndexEndpointRequest,IndexEndpoint> updateIndexEndpointCallable()
-
deleteIndexEndpointO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eleteIndexEndpointRequest,com.google.protobuf.Empty,DeleteOperationMetadata> deleteIndexEndpointOperationCallable()
-
deleteIndexEndpointCallable
public com.google.api.gax.rpc.UnaryCallable<DeleteIndexEndpointRequest,com.google.longrunning.Operation> deleteIndexEndpointCallable()
-
deployIndexOperationCallable
public com.google.api.gax.rpc.OperationCallable<DeployIndexRequest,DeployIndexResponse,DeployIndexOperationMetadata> deployIndexOperationCallable()
-
deployIndexCallable
public com.google.api.gax.rpc.UnaryCallable<DeployIndexRequest,com.google.longrunning.Operation> deployIndexCallable()
-
undeployIndexOperationCallable
public com.google.api.gax.rpc.OperationCallable<UndeployIndexRequest,UndeployIndexResponse,UndeployIndexOperationMetadata> undeployIndexOperationCallable()
-
undeployIndexCallable
public com.google.api.gax.rpc.UnaryCallable<UndeployIndexRequest,com.google.longrunning.Operation> undeployIndexCallable()
-
mutateDeployedIndexOperationCallable
public com.google.api.gax.rpc.OperationCallable<MutateDeployedIndexRequest,MutateDeployedIndexResponse,MutateDeployedIndexOperationMetadata> mutateDeployedIndexOperationCallable()
-
mutateDeployedIndexCallable
public com.google.api.gax.rpc.UnaryCallable<MutateDeployedIndexRequest,com.google.longrunning.Operation> mutateDeployedIndexCallable()
-
listLocationsPagedC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.cloud.location.ListLocationsRequest,IndexEndpointServiceClient.ListLocationsPagedResponse> listLocationsPagedCallable()
-
listLocationsC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.cloud.location.ListLocationsRequest,com.google.cloud.location.ListLocationsResponse> listLocationsCallable()
-
getLocationC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.cloud.location.GetLocationRequest,com.google.cloud.location.Location> getLocationCallable()
-
setIamPolicyC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.SetIamPolicyRequest,com.google.iam.v1.Policy> setIamPolicyCallable()
-
getIamPolicyC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.GetIamPolicyRequest,com.google.iam.v1.Policy> getIamPolicyCallable()
-
testIamPermissionsCallable
public com.google.api.gax.rpc.UnaryCallable<com.google.iam.v1.TestIamPermissionsRequest,com.google.iam.v1.TestIamPermissionsResponse> testIamPermissionsCallable()
-
close
public abstract void close()
- Specified by:
close
in interfaceAutoCloseable
-
-